Description
More than 70 math games, puzzles, and projects from all over the world are included in this delightful book for kids.
Author Biography
Claudia Zaslavsky has been a maths teacher and maths teacher's teacher since 1959 and was one of the first educators to emphasise multicultural perspectives in math. She is the author of 13 books and lives in New York City.
